Copper Services Launches 'YouTube' for Meeting Content

Good meetings have good content — the finding and sharing of which has just become a little bit easier thanks to Copper Services, which last week announced the launch of Convey, a "business content catalog" that allows meeting planners and other business professionals to create and consume educational content.

Copper Services, a Denver-based provider of virtual meeting technology, describes Convey as the "YouTube of business information." Using it, event planners and others can download educational content — much of which is free — in the form of articles, white papers, reports, podcasts, presentations, webinars, e-books or videos. Simultaneously, they can post content from their own events, monetizing it, if they choose, by charging a fee to those who download it.

"Convey creates an opportunity for professionals to market their expertise, develop a following within the marketplace and generate revenue from their content," said Copper Services CEO Carolyn Bradfield. "There is a huge demand among speakers, consultants, training groups and associations to independently host their content and potentially monetize it. Individuals and organizations can earn money by offering informative and educational content for sale and letting Convey manage the payment process."

Although there are no fees to post content on Convey, Copper Services does charge a small percentage of revenue when content is sold. Additionally, it pre-screens all Convey content to ensure that it's focused on business, and is informative or educational.

"There are dozens of sites that mix business with consumer content; however, business professionals don't want to waste time sifting through videos of skateboarding dogs or promotional advertising to find expertise, ideas or continuing education that is relevant to them," Bradfield continued.

Convey users can search for content by topic, industry or keyword, and can either view it online or download it. Those who post content may offer it for free or for a fee. Those who charge can customize pricing, offer specialized discounts, develop refund policies and offer free content previews.
